The Importance of Relaxation in Relationships

Relaxation plays a crucial role in our emotional well-being. When we are relaxed, we are more open, empathetic, and capable of connecting with others. Here are some key reasons why relaxation is vital for relationships:

  • Reduces Stress: Stress can create barriers in communication and lead to misunderstandings.
  • Enhances Empathy: A relaxed mind is more capable of understanding and empathizing with others.
  • Improves Communication: Relaxation fosters clarity of thought, leading to more effective conversations.

Relaxation Techniques to Enhance Relationships

There are various relaxation techniques that can be easily integrated into daily life. Here are some effective methods:

  • Deep Breathing: Simple deep breathing exercises can calm the mind and body, making you more present in conversations.
  • Meditation: Regular meditation can improve emotional regulation and increase your ability to connect with others.
  • Yoga: Practicing yoga not only relaxes the body but also promotes mindfulness, which can enhance social interactions.
  • Progressive Muscle Relaxation: This technique helps to release tension in the body, making you feel more at ease during social situations.

Building Social Skills Through Relaxation

Relaxation techniques not only strengthen relationships but also build essential social skills. Here’s how:

  • Active Listening: A relaxed state allows you to focus better on what others are saying, improving your listening skills.
  • Confidence: Relaxation can boost your self-confidence, making you more willing to engage in social situations.
  • Non-Verbal Communication: Being relaxed helps you to read and respond to non-verbal cues more effectively.
  • Conflict Resolution: A calm demeanor can help you navigate conflicts more effectively, leading to healthier relationships.

Practical Tips for Incorporating Relaxation Techniques

To reap the benefits of relaxation, consider these practical tips for incorporating techniques into your daily routine:

  • Set Aside Time: Dedicate specific times each day for relaxation practices.
  • Create a Relaxing Environment: Find a quiet space where you can practice relaxation techniques without distractions.
  • Combine Techniques: Experiment with combining different relaxation methods to find what works best for you.
  • Practice Mindfulness: Incorporate mindfulness into your daily activities to stay present and reduce stress.
